What's it all about?
Ifs is a registered charity whose purpose is to provide structured financial education. It has today launched a challenge for uni students to invest a fantasy £100,000 to help you learn about shares, bonds, gilts and the rest with the winner taking home a tidy £9K. Post grad students can also take part but the prize is only £3,000 for them.
How to take part
Simply go to the Uni Investor site and register your details. You'll need to include details of a lecturer and their e-mail addres so make sure you check it out with them first.
Trading starts 1 February 2007 and ends 30 April 2007. Once you have opened your account you will be given a fantasy £100,000 with the aim to make it grow as much as possible.
You can check your performance against others in the challenge or those from your particular uni; you can also set up your own league tables to hot up the competition.
At the end of the trading period, the top 30 participants will be invited to submit a short report or essay on a related topic to determine the overall winners.

Game Rules
- Competition trading runs from 1 February 2007 until 30 April 2007.
- You must be 18yrs or over and a student at a university or higher education college to participate. You will need to provide the name and contact details of one of your lecturers who can vouch that you are an eligible student.
- You may play as an individual or as part of a team.
- You can invest in shares in any UK listed company, as well as benchmark gilts and you can even go 'short'.
- The team or individual in first place in the Undergraduate category will receive a cheque for £9000.
- The team or individual in first place in the Postgraduate category will receive a cheque for £3000.
- There will also be 10 runner-up prizes in each category, which will be announced when the Challenge opens.
- The team or individual with the best performing portfolio at the end of 30 April 2007 will receive a cheque for £200.
- The team or individual with the best performing portfolio at the end of each trading month will receive a cheque for £150. This prize can only be won once by a team or individual during the Challenge.
